The club had five state champions and all 12 riders who competed earned a state number plate for placing in the top 10 in their respective divisions.
Dominic McCarty (5 Novice), Jackson Wergin (6 Intermediate), Matthew Schettino (6 Expert), McKaelynn Schettino (11 Girls Expert) and Cassandra Walkowski (21-30 Women's Expert) all won state championships.
James Wergin (8 Expert), Alexander Aguirre (12 Expert) and Owen Ives (12 Cruiser) were state runners-up. Ives also finished third in the 12 Expert class.
Mason Schettino finished fourth in the 8 Intermediate Class, Michael Schettino was fifth in the 10 Expert class, Armando Aguirre was sixth in the 11 Expert class and Dalton McCarty was 10th in the 9 Intermediate Class.
"Five state champs out of Hodag BMX is a big deal and something the community should be proud of," track spokesperson Beth Ives Sachse said. "Not just the No. 1s, but all the racers represented our little track and town well."
To be eligible, riders had to compete in three of seven state qualifier events held throughout the 2018 season. The Hodag BMX track held a state qualifier race in late July.
